Philly Cheesesteak Egg Rolls are a delicious twist on the classic Philly Cheesesteak sandwich. Instead of using a traditional hoagie roll, the filling is wrapped in an egg roll wrapper and then fried until crispy. The result is a flavorful combination of thinly sliced steak, melted cheese, sautéed onions, and sometimes peppers, all packed into a crunchy shell.
To make Philly Cheesesteak Egg Rolls, you’ll need the following ingredients:
– Thinly sliced steak (such as ribeye or sirloin)
– Sliced provolone or American cheese
– Sliced onions
– Sliced bell peppers (optional)
– Egg roll wrappers
– Vegetable oil (for frying)
– Salt and pepper (to taste)
